This business-friendly hotel is located in Barcelona's Ciutat Vella neighborhood, close to University of Barcelona, Palau de la Generalitat de Catalunya, and Placa Catalunya. Also nearby are Placa Reial and Casa Batllo. Show more
Restaurant, bar/lounge
In addition to a restaurant, Grupotel Gravina features a business center. Other amenities include a bar/lounge and laundry facilities.
Satellite television
Televisions come with satellite channels. Guestrooms also feature air conditioning, minibars, and safes. Hide

Rooms

Grupotel Gravina offers 84 air-conditioned accommodations with minibars and safes. Televisions come with satellite channels and complimentary TV Internet access.

Rooms are equipped with wireless Internet access. Business-friendly amenities include desks, complimentary newspapers, and direct-dial phones. Additionally, rooms include coffee/tea makers and hair dryers.

When to go
September was beautiful. The Barcelona Bus Turistic is a fantastic way to see the City. We did the Red and Green Tour on Saturday and Blue on Sunday. The beaches, which you get to on the Green route, are absolutely fabulous. I thought there was a small strip of beach. There are are 5 of them, and the sand is beautiful. On Sunday, if you want to do the Nou Camp Stadium Tour, the last one starts at 1.30pm and finishes at 2.30. The Metro is also a great way to get around. Just be aware that some unsavoury people will be out to get your money. I was sprayed with some warm liquid from behind me, which i assumed was from a bird. A man appeared as my boyfriend was getting tissues, and offered me kitchen towel. I thanked him and as we were concentrating on the mess, he had his hand in my bag. Fortunately, I spotted him and gave him a slap. H e ran off emptyhanded . Be alert but don't be put off.

Getting there
Getting a taxi from the airport was very easy and cost about 25 euro (about 15 minute journey), but the taxi from the hotel to the airport cost 43 euro! A fellow traveller advised us to load our cases into the car ourselves & not let the taxi driver do this for us, unfortunately on the return journey he was too quick for us! In hindsight I would have used the bus service from Plaza Cataluna to the airport which only costs about 2 euro.
Getting around
I would recommend buying a ticket for the tourist bus (22 euro). This takes either an east or west route & stops at all of the major attractions, well worth it.

Area:

Ciutat Vella, Barcelona, Spain: Barcelona's Old Town, the Ciutat Vella takes in the Barri Gòtic and the world-famous promenade of Las Ramblas. The former is the city's medieval core, a maze of atmospheric alleyways clustered around the splendid Gothic Cathedral. Quirky specialist shops and characterful bars and eateries abound. Don't miss the Museu Picasso and the Museu d'Història de la Ciutat, as much for their palatial settings as their content.
